Transaction 709d9a82bb73c12ff19276dd8a1066e578482f4cbeb97971142d82ef084bbc8e

2 Input
2 Outputs
  • 709d9a82bb73c12ff19276dd8a1066e578482f4cbeb97971142d82ef084bbc8e:0
  • value  50000000
    address  17tuJ7LxHaxZvTQZHMByU2t4e7syy6qXaR
  • 709d9a82bb73c12ff19276dd8a1066e578482f4cbeb97971142d82ef084bbc8e:1
  • value  157493
    address  177sdbSsARaxkhqF62cPbYz5eeEKm1C25S